    GRAND CENTRAL TERMINAL
    42ND AND PARK AVE
    NEW YORK CITY, NEW YORK -USA
    Location: NEW YORK CITY, NY
    Description:
  • RAILROAD DEPOT
  • RAIL PASSENGER SERVICE
  • HISTORICAL LANDMARK
  • Comments/Directions:
    Grand Central Terminal, often called Grand Central Station or simply Grand Central is a terminal station in midtown Manhattan, New York City. Built in 1913 for the New York Central Railroad, it is the largest train station in the world by number of platforms: 44 with 67 tracks. They are below ground on two levels, with 41 tracks on the upper level and 26 on the lower. The terminal serves commuters traveling on the Metro-North Railroad. Grand Central is listed on the National Register of Historic Places and a National Historic Landmark. It's grand Hall has been used a the setting for many movies and documentaries.

    POUGHKEEPSIE HIGHLAND RAILROAD BRIDGE
    POUGHKEEPSIE, NEW YORK -USA
    Location: POUGHKEEPSIE, NY
    Description:
  • RAILROAD BRIDGE
  • Comments/Directions:
    The Poughkeepsie Highland Railroad Bridge, which has remained dormant since the mid-1970s when fire rendered it unable to carry trains across the Hudson River, will be developed into a state park. The bridge will be developed into a walkway and bikeway park with breathtaking views of the Hudson. When built in 1888, in typical New York style, was the longest bridge in the world, an engineering marvel. For the last three decades; however, the bridge has sat empty and unused. As a pedestrian bridge over the Hudson, it will allow New Yorkers to connect to the history and natural beauty of the state and draw them to Poughkeepsie, Kingston and surrounding communities.

    SALAMANCA RAIL MUSEUM
    170 MAIN ST.
    SALAMANCA, NEW YORK 14799 -
    Location: 80 MILES S. OF BUFFALOOFF US 219
    Phone: 716-945-3133
    Description:
  • RAILROAD MUSEUM
  • Web Site SALAMANCA RAIL MUSEUM INFORMATION
    Email Address
    Comments/Directions:
    Museum in old Buffalo, Rochester and Pittsburgh Station. Station fully restored. Freight station next door along with a few old rail cars. Across the tracks and up a few hundred yards is the old Erie station. A larger, more majestic station, it is in fairly good shape but abandoned. Portion of old Erie yard is within sight from the stations, as well as a few remains of the yard works. On the other side of town (1/2 mile) is the Buffalo, Rochester and Pittsburgh East Salamanca Yard and station. This includes most of the old cars shops, however the roundhouse has been removed. Most of the tracks have also been removed, however the station is in good shape and is used by B&P work crews. The museum itself features a variety of RR equipment. I also found two scale models of the old coaling towers impressive. A large number of pictures from the area may also be found.

    Email Address
    Comments/Directions:
    Rail City Museum was the first steam-operating railroad museum in the United States. Located on the eastern shore of Lake Ontario, Rail City offered visitors a unique opportunity to view an extensive collection of railroad structures and equipment that included 16 steam locomotives and over 50 pieces of rolling stock. The highlight of the museum was a 1.5. mile steam train ride. The history of Rail City is fascinating account of an eccentric visionary, Dr. Stanley A. Groman from Syracuse, NY, single-handedly saved a score of railroad locomotives, cars, track and structures from the scrap heap. The December, 1995 issue of trains magazine states: "Stanley A Groman's museum in upstate New York was a pioneering example of railroad preservation...back in the 1950's as the steam era was facing fast, it took people like Stanley Groman to begin the work of saving locomotives, cars and structures for generations to come." During the construction of Rail City, old #38, a 2-8-0 Baldwin locomotive, made the final steam passenger run on the New York Central System in New York State. Dr. Groman collected the only remaining street cars from Scranton, PA, Rochester, NY, and the Lake Erie and Northern Railway. Some rolling stock came from as far away as Gallup, NM. Despite all of the energy that Dr. Groman directed into the construction of Rail City, it closed in 1974. The steam railroad museum was just simply ahead of its time. In 1991, 17 years after Rail City closed, Dr. Groman's son, Bob, discovered his father's negatives and spent six years developing and researching over 2,000 photographs taken during the acquisition of equipment and construction of Rail City. The story of Rail City is actually the story of a number of well known railroads that Dr. Groman acquired equipment from. In addition, Dr. Groman amassed a respectable collection of steam-era photographs, time tables, art prints, and other rarilroad memorabilia. The Deer River Station (from Deer River, NY), dismantled and reconstructed on the site of Rail City by Dr. Groman in 1954, has been restored and now contains a wealth of railroad photographs, time tables, memorabilia as well as a railroad gift shop. The Rail City Historical Musuem opened on memorial Day in 1997 is a grand trip down memory lane and an exciting look back on the history of the American Railroads
